Wife had to stop at a yarn shop while we were in the city. Next door was a Dick's. With nothing to read in the truck I went in talked to a clerk in hunting area he told me that last week or the first of this week he was told to take the Mossberg 930 and one other gun off the shelf, sorry I can not remember the other one. He asked the manager the reason and was told corp said it fit Sen. Feinstein gun ban bill discription. I talked a short while with him, he is a revolver fan, and told him I would see him at the range but never in the store again. I will not support that type of business. He understood and said I was not the first to tell him that.
